Job description

Join Our Mission Park DuValle Community Health Center is seeking a Credentialing Coordinator to serve as the primary liaison between our organization and an external credentialing partner.

While the majority of the initial credentialing process will be managed by the third-party credentialing company, this role will monitor progress and ensure compliance with requirements, maintain provider records, and coordinate communication among stakeholders. The Credentialing Coordinator will be responsible for monitoring provider enrollment status, tracking recredentialing deadlines, and utilizing our electronic medical record system to manage and update provider enrollment information. This role will also work closely with our Revenue Cycle and Finance Team to investigate and resolve payer-related claim denials, identify enrollment issues impacting reimbursement, and assist with corrective actions to prevent gaps in reimbursement.

Key Responsibilities
  • Serve as the primary liaison between Park DuValle Community Health Center and the external credentialing vendor regarding credentialing and provider enrollment activities.
  • Coordinate the collection of required documentation for provider payer enrollment, including Medicaid, Medicare, and other payer requirements.
  • Track the status of provider payer enrollment, recredentialing, and revalidation applications.
  • Maintain organized and accurate credentialing and payer enrollment files, including application status, supporting documentation, and payer correspondence.
  • Communicate provider updates, including practice location changes, reassignment of benefits, and other required information, to the credentialing vendor.
  • Follow up with the credentialing vendor and payers regarding outstanding documentation, application status, and processing delays.
  • Update provider information within the electronic medical record (EMR) and other internal systems as needed.
  • Collaborate with Human Resources to ensure required onboarding documentation is collected for provider credentialing and payer enrollment.
  • Support resolution of credentialing denials, requests for additional information, and revalidation requirements.
  • Work with Revenue Cycle and Finance teams to investigate payer-related claim denials and enrollment issues that may impact reimbursement.
  • Monitor credentialing timelines and help ensure required documentation, renewals, and revalidations are completed on schedule.
  • Prepare routine reports and maintain accurate records related to provider credentialing and enrollment activities.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.
Requirements
  • Associate's degree in healthcare administration, Business Administration, or a related field.
  • Two years of experience in healthcare administration, provider enrollment, credentialing support, or healthcare billing; or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Experience working with healthcare providers, credentialing vendors, or payer organizations.
  • Familiarity with provider credentialing and/or enrollment processes.
  • Exposure to CAQH and healthcare payer systems.
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ities and deadlines.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• High attention to detail and accuracy in documentation and data entry.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ite, including Excel, Word, and Outlook.
  • Ability to quickly learn credentialing software, payer portals, and electronic medical record (EMR) systems.
  •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to collaborate effectively with providers, vendors, and cross-functional teams.
  • Customer service mindset with strong problem-solving abilities.
